The first thing you need to know is that cooking pizza rolls in an air fryer is easy. It’s a simple process that requires minimal effort and cleanup. Just add your pizza rolls to the basket, set the temperature and timer, and let the air fryer do its magic. But, there are a few things you need to keep in mind to ensure that your pizza rolls turn out perfectly. First, you need to preheat the air fryer. This is an important step that ensures your pizza rolls cook evenly and thoroughly.
Preheating the air fryer is easy. Simply plug it in, set the temperature to 400°F, and let it heat up for a few minutes. Once it’s preheated, you can add your pizza rolls to the basket and start cooking. But, what if you’re short on time? Can you cook pizza rolls without preheating the air fryer? The answer is yes, but it’s not recommended. Preheating the air fryer ensures that your pizza rolls cook evenly and thoroughly, and it helps to prevent them from sticking to the basket.
Now that we’ve covered the basics, let’s talk about the best way to cook pizza rolls in an air fryer. The key is to cook them at the right temperature and for the right amount of time. The ideal temperature for cooking pizza rolls is between 375°F and 400°F. This temperature range produces a crispy exterior and a tender interior, and it helps to prevent the pizza rolls from burning or overcooking.
In addition to temperature, cooking time is also important. The cooking time will depend on the size and thickness of your pizza rolls, as well as your personal preference for crispiness. As a general rule, you should cook pizza rolls for 5-7 minutes, or until they’re golden brown and crispy. But, what if you like your pizza rolls extra crispy? You can cook them for an additional 1-2 minutes, or until they reach your desired level of crispiness.

Preventing Pizza Rolls from Sticking to the Air Fryer Basket
Preventing pizza rolls from sticking to the air fryer basket is an important step that ensures your pizza rolls cook evenly and thoroughly. There are a few ways to prevent sticking, including spraying the basket with cooking spray, using parchment paper, or using a silicone mat.
The first way to prevent sticking is to spray the basket with cooking spray. This is a simple and effective way to prevent pizza rolls from sticking to the basket, and it’s a great way to ensure that your pizza rolls cook evenly and thoroughly. Simply spray the basket with cooking spray before adding your pizza rolls, and you’re good to go.
Another way to prevent sticking is to use parchment paper. This is a great way to prevent pizza rolls from sticking to the basket, and it’s also a great way to make cleanup easier. Simply place a piece of parchment paper in the basket before adding your pizza rolls, and you’re good to go.
Finally, you can use a silicone mat to prevent sticking. This is a great way to prevent pizza rolls from sticking to the basket, and it’s also a great way to make cleanup easier. Simply place the silicone mat in the basket before adding your pizza rolls, and you’re good to go.
In addition to these methods, there are a few other things you can do to prevent sticking. One thing you can do is to make sure the basket is clean and dry before adding your pizza rolls. This will help to prevent sticking and ensure that your pizza rolls cook evenly and thoroughly.
Another thing you can do is to not overcrowd the basket. This can cause the pizza rolls to stick together, and it can also cause them to stick to the basket. Instead, cook your pizza rolls in batches, and make sure to leave enough space between each roll for even cooking.

The Best Temperature to Cook Pizza Rolls in an Air Fryer
The best temperature to cook pizza rolls in an air fryer is between 375°F and 400°F. This temperature range produces a crispy exterior and a tender interior, and it helps to prevent the pizza rolls from burning or overcooking.
Cooking pizza rolls at the right temperature is important because it ensures that they cook evenly and thoroughly. If the temperature is too low, the pizza rolls may not cook properly, and they may be raw or undercooked in the center. On the other hand, if the temperature is too high, the pizza rolls may burn or overcook, and they may be dry and crispy.
To cook pizza rolls at the right temperature, you can use the temperature control on your air fryer. Simply set the temperature to the desired level, and the air fryer will do the rest. You can also use a thermometer to check the temperature of the air fryer, and you can adjust the temperature as needed.

How to Know When Your Pizza Rolls Are Done Cooking in the Air Fryer
Knowing when your pizza rolls are done cooking in the air fryer is an important step that ensures they are cooked to perfection. There are a few ways to know when your pizza rolls are done cooking, including checking the temperature, checking the texture, and checking the color.
The first way to know when your pizza rolls are done cooking is to check the temperature. You can use a thermometer to check the internal temperature of the pizza rolls, and you can adjust the cooking time and temperature as needed. The ideal internal temperature for cooked pizza rolls is between 165°F and 180°F.
The second way to know when your pizza rolls are done cooking is to check the texture. Cooked pizza rolls should be crispy on the outside and tender on the inside. If they are still raw or undercooked, they may be soft and squishy. You can check the texture by cutting into one of the pizza rolls, and you can adjust the cooking time and temperature as needed.
The third way to know when your pizza rolls are done cooking is to check the color. Cooked pizza rolls should be golden brown and crispy, and they may have a slightly darker color on the outside. If they are still raw or undercooked, they may be pale and soft. You can check the color by looking at the pizza rolls, and you can adjust the cooking time and temperature as needed.

What is the best way to store leftover pizza rolls?
The best way to store leftover pizza rolls is to place them in an airtight container and store them in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. You can also freeze them for up to 2 months and reheat them in the air fryer when you’re ready to eat them.
To store leftover pizza rolls, simply place them in an airtight container and store them in the refrigerator. You can also wrap them individually in plastic wrap or aluminum foil and store them in the refrigerator or freezer.
When reheating leftover pizza rolls, make sure to reheat them to an internal temperature of at least 165°F to ensure food safety. You can reheat them in the air fryer, oven, or microwave, and you can also add seasonings and toppings to give them extra flavor.

Can I cook pizza rolls in a conventional oven instead of an air fryer?
Yes, you can cook pizza rolls in a conventional oven instead of an air fryer. In fact, cooking pizza rolls in a conventional oven is a great way to achieve a crispy exterior and a tender interior, and it’s a convenient option for people who don’t have an air fryer.
To cook pizza rolls in a conventional oven, simply preheat the oven to 400°F and place the pizza rolls on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. You can also spray the pizza rolls with a small amount of oil and season with salt and pepper.
Cook the pizza rolls in the oven for 12-15 minutes, or until they are golden brown and crispy. You can also cook them for a shorter amount of time if you prefer a softer crust.
